2

首先,你必须得有开发者账号,如何申请开发者账号,这里就不再累赘,请自行百度。

一、什么时候使用ad hoc证书


app发布之前,一般都要在真机上面进行测试,所以需要打包测试版(这不废话吗)

二、证书的创建与使用流程


在创建证书之前我们需要在我们的电脑上生成一个Certificate Signing Request即证书注册请求文件,找到mac下的“钥匙串访问”点击进入操作界面

图片描述

图片描述

图片描述

选择“存储到磁盘”,点击存储之后我们会获得这样一个文件,请记住文件路径(笑脸)
接下来我们登陆苹果开发者账号,Certificates-Development
点+号新增证书

图片描述

图片描述

图片描述

图片描述

Choose file 选择刚刚下载的证书

图片描述

此时你应该拥有了一个测试证书了,点击download并安装,你在钥匙串里面就能看到你的测试证书了。

三.创建app ids


图片描述

点击右上角的+号

图片描述

Bundle ID栏中填写的必须和你的xcode -Bundle Identifier中的内容保持一致
完善表单,提交submit就可以完成这一步的操作

四、创建测试设备


点击左侧菜单的Devices下的all 来添加我们所支持的运行设备,填写设备的nama,UDID可以通过itunes查看,完善表单添加测试设备

五、创建Provisioning Profiles文件


图片描述

图片描述

选择我们之前创建的app id

Continue

选择我们创建的调试证书

图片描述

双击安装

六、xcode 如图操作点击preferences添加你的开发者账号


图片描述

图片描述

七、接下来我们去xcode,Team这行里选择你刚才账号中的team Name中显示的名字


图片描述
图片描述
图片描述
图片描述
图片描述
图片描述
图片描述

设置Target-General-Signing,x-code8 有一个Automatically manage signing,此时要去掉勾选,然后配置Provisioning Profile 为刚刚创建好的 adhoc 配置文件

图片描述

八.此时所有环境都配置完成


菜单选择 Product -> Archive,然后等待编译

九.还不打包?


图片描述
图片描述
图片描述
图片描述

十,接下来我们点next,等待build就可以得到ipa包,再通过第三方插件给手机安装上即可测试。


码字太累了,全流程大家尽量看图,有不完善的地方,敬请谷歌!!


Jeff
70 声望8 粉丝

前后左右端